Section 3. Coding and
Transmission of NOTAMs
4-3-1. PREPARATION FOR
TRANSMISSION
In order to ensure that NOTAMs are
processed and distributed properly, data for transmission must be coded as
prescribed in this order.
4-3-2. AUTOMATIC DATA
PROCESSING (ADP) CODES
The ADP equipment is programmed to accept
and begin processing a NOTAM upon receipt of the ADP code.
4-3-3. NOTAM
TRANSMISSION
a. The
following examples illustrate the proper coding of NOTAM data for
transmission by stations entering their own NOTAM data in the system.
EXAMPLE-
AISR Format:
GG KDZZNAXX
131345 KPIRYFYX
!PIR PIR NAV VOR OUT OF SERVICE
13061512001311302359
b. The
following example illustrates the proper coding of NOTAM data for
transmission by a station entering NOTAM data into the system for a tiein
location.
EXAMPLE-
AISR Format:
GG KDZZNAXX
131345 KPIRYFYX
!EKN W22 AD AIRPORT CLSD
13070400001307061200
c. When
two or more new NOTAMs or cancellations, or combinations of new NOTAMs and
cancellations are transmitted in the same message, they must be separated by
the ADP code and a new line.
EXAMPLE-
AISR Format:
GG KDZZNAXX
131500 KABQYFYX
!ABQ C04/003
!ABQ ABQ RWY 8/26 CLSD 13070400001307061200
!ABQ C02/057
NOTE-
No confirmation will be received on cancellations.
4-3-4. TRANSMISSION OF
NOTAMs EXCEEDING 20 LINES
If the text of a NOTAM is expected to
exceed 20 lines, you must call the USNOF (1-888-876-6826) for assistance in
composition and guidance.
4-3-5. CONFIRMING
ACCEPTANCE BY THE NOTAM SYSTEM
a. When
a new NOTAM is accepted into the NOTAM file, a copy of the NOTAM with the
NOTAM number will be returned back to the originating facility and sent to
WMSCR for distribution.
EXAMPLE-
(Confirmation)
GG KDENYFYX
131346 KDZZNAXX
!DEN 04/003 DEN NAV VOR OUT OF SERVICE
13070400001307061200
b. If
the NOTAM is rejected, a USNSgenerated service message will be relayed back
to the facility of origin indicating the reason for rejection as shown in
Paragraph 4-5-2,
NOTAM Service Messages.
4-3-6. TRANSMISSION BY
ANOTHER FACILITY
When unable to transmit a NOTAM directly
into the system due to equipment failure or other situation, relay the
information to another facility and request that the data be transmitted
into the system.
4-3-7. RETRIEVING
DOMESTIC NOTAMs
Domestic NOTAMs must be retrieved via
National Airspace Data Interchange Network (NADIN) using the following
formats:
a. When
the location identifier and number are known:
AISR Format:
GG KDZZNAXX
041503 KTUSYFYX
)SVC RQ DOM LOC=CID NT=02/020
b. When the accountability identifier and
number are known:
AISR Format:
GG KDZZNAXX
051612 KYNGYFYX
)SVC RQ DOM ACC=FOD NT=03/040
c.
To request all NOTAMs for a given location:
AISR Format:
GG KDZZNAXX
061832 KBZNYFYX
)SVC RQ DOM LOC=DSM
d.
To request all NOTAMs for a given accountability:
AISR Format:
GG KDZZNAXX
061832 KBZNYFYX
)SVC RQ DOM ACC=FOD
